Peri-sident

Interestingly the media only focused on how our president ogled at the vice-president nominee and flirted with her. Probably it can simply be dismissed as a ridiculous attempt at impersonating an 'american attitude' where he tried to over compensate his 'ghunda' impression. The only other explanation is to believe into all the rumours being spread on SMS these days (and if you don't know what I mean, get on somone's distribution list!).

The point that has concerned me is why US before China and why didn't it make any news when (and if) he met Obama? And if he didn't why are we gambling all our chips on the Republicans???

Still the media attention on just one single point baffles me and leads me to conclude safely that if (Inshallah) things get better in Pakistan, it will put alot of TV channels out of work. Its sad but I think our recent media boom is a side effect of political and social turmoil in the country. Which now has become a chicken and egg story much like the decline of our film industry in the 80s at the hands of glorified violent characters. Whether the media reporting encourages more violence and distress or just reports something which is already there; don't think this can ever be answered.

So if the powers that be are listening, you can get rid of the 'hum sab umeed se hain' garbage by simply making things better in the country :) and let the channels starve to death.
